Levitt, Helen. Helen Levitt. September 14-October 10, 1984. Untitled (Friends of Photography) is a seminal and controversialBlue Sky Gallery, Portland, Oregon, 1984. Stapled wraps, 12 pages including covers, 12 illustrations. Black and white photographs taken in New York in the 1940s. Scarce, only three copies in libraries listed in WorldCat. Like new. Summary: Helen Levitt is a scarce, 12 page exhibition catalog published by the Blue Sky Gallery (the Oregon Center for the Photographic Arts) in Portland, Oregon.
